- ベストアンサー
テキストボックスに再表示させるには?
こんばんは。 vb始めたばかりの初心者ですがお願いします。 環境はvb6.0を使用してます。 vb6.0で【1*2+9】という感じで数式を書く電卓を作っているのですが、 電卓はなんとかできたのですが、 プログラムを終了してマタ実行した時に前回入力した式をテキストボックスに表示させたいのですが、どの様なソースを書けばいいのか誰か教えて下さい。 お願いします。
- slylove88
- お礼率20% (1/5)
- Visual Basic
- 回答数1
- ありがとう数1
- みんなの回答 (1)
- 専門家の回答
質問者が選んだベストアンサー
簡単なのは、ファイルにその情報を保存しておいて、アプリが起動されたらファイルをチェックしに行って、データがあれば表示するってのはどうでしょうか?
関連するQ&A
- テキストBOXに入力した数式をプログラムソースとして使うには
VB5.0でテキストBOXに数式(y=2*xのような式)を入力すると、文字列と認識しますが、これを変数化してプログラムのソースにしたいのです。どのような方法があるでしょうか。 ぜひ、お教えください。よろしくお願い致します。
- 締切済み
- Visual Basic
- テキストボックスのバグでしょうか?
VB5(SP3)を使用しています。 例えばフォームにテキストボックスを2つ貼りつけて、プログラムを実行します。 IMEの入力設定を「ローマ字入力」の状態で始めたとします。 最初のテキストボックスでキーボードの【Alt】+【カタカナ・ひらがな/ローマ字】を押しても「かな入力」になりません。次のテキストボックスにカーソルを移動すると「かな入力」が有効になります。 ACCESSとかだとその場で有効になります。 これはVBのバグなのでしょうか? 使用PC:DOS/V 使用OS:WindowsNT4.0
- 締切済み
- Visual Basic
- NumericUpDownを使用してテキストボックスに表示させたいのですが
プログラミング初心者です、VB 2008を使用しています。 NumericUpDownを使用して数字をアップダウン表示させることはできたのですが、たとえば「ボタン」を押したら「テキストボックス」に入力した数値を反映させるプログラムの記述があれば教えていただきたいです。 よろしくお願いします。
- ベストアンサー
- その他(プログラミング・開発)
- VB6のテキストボックスについて
VB6で作成したプログラムを実行すると、WIN95とWIN98とで違う動作をします。 テキストボックスを右詰め(数字入力のため)に設定しているのですが、 WIN98で実行すると問題なく動作し、 WIN95で実行すると常に左詰めになってしまいます。 常に右詰めになるようにするにはどうしたらいいのでしょうか。
- ベストアンサー
- Visual Basic
- テキストBOXに入力した数式をプログラムソースとして使用する方法
テキストBOXに数式を入力すると、文字列と認識しますが、これを変数化して プログラムのソースにしたいのです。どのような方法があるでしょうか。 ぜひ、お教えください。よろしくお願い致します。
- ベストアンサー
- Visual Basic
- テキストボックスについて
使っている環境はVB6.0です。 テキストボックスが2つあり、1つ目のテキストボックスでEnterキーを押すとテキストボックスの2つ目にフォーカスが移動するというものなのですが、その移動したときに2つ目のテキストボックスの文字が選択されている状況を作りたいのですが何か良い方法はないでしょうか? 文字は最初から入っている前提でお願いします。
- ベストアンサー
- Visual Basic
- テキストボックスの入力制限
VB2005環境です。 ・全角文字のみ入力を受け付けるテキストボックス ・半角文字のみ入力を受け付けるテキストボックス 以上のような入力制限を持つコントロールを用意したいと思っています。 MaskedTextBoxを用いればできるかと思いましたが、それらしき プロパティが見当たりませんでした。 やはりキーイベントを取得して…ということになるのでしょうか?
- ベストアンサー
- Visual Basic
- Accessのクエリデザインで条件抽出のテキストボックス
アクセス初心者です。 既に作成済みのクエリを実行する時、いつも「開始日」と「終了日」を入力するテキストボックスが 出てきていました。 例えば開始日のボックスに2009/04/01を入力してEnterを押すと次に終了日を入力する ボックスが出てきて2009/05/31と入力して実行するとそのデータベースのその日付の期間の データが抽出されるようになっていました。 あるとき必要がありそのクエリのデザインを開き別のテーブルの抽出条件を追加したり していたときに、その日付(登録日時というテーブル)の部分の抽出条件を消してしまいました。 元通りにしたいのですが、どのような式が入力されていたのかわかりません。 私なりに調べてみて、テキストボックスは表示されないのですが、クエリのデザインを 開いている状態でそこに 「Between #2009/04/01# And #2009/05/31#」などと日付を入力すればできることは わかったのですが、テキストボックスが表示されるように元通りにすることはわかりませんでした。 お分かりになる方、教えてください。
- ベストアンサー
- オフィス系ソフト
- 数値型のテキストボックスを文字型に変えたい
環境:XP&ACCESS2003 数値型のコントロールソースを持つテキストボックスがあります。このテキストボックスに、例えば「8+7」と入力するために、文字型に変換したいのですが。 *このコントロールソースの更新後処理に Me!テキスト0 = Eval(テキスト0) と記述しています。 数値型なので、「数値型の為入力できません」旨のエラーが出てしまいます。
- ベストアンサー
- その他(データベース)
- vb6(access2000)でWebBrowserを使いテキストボックスに入力をしたい
開発環境 VB6 Access2000 WebBrowserでページを表示させ、そこにあるテキストボックス --ソースは<input type="text" name="aaa" となっている-- に値を入力する方法を教えてください。 また、submit-ボタンを押す方法も教えていただければと思います。 検索しても最近は.NET環境のものばかりで、vb6しかもってないので苦労しております。 よろしくお願いいたします。
- ベストアンサー
- Visual Basic
お礼
ape5さん解決しました!! ありがとうございます♪
補足
ape5さん回答ありがとうございます。 お手数をお掛けしますが時間があれば例えのソースを教えてもらってもよろしいでしょうか?